Outstanding Individuals Shine at Gala Dinner

In its third year, RFP Magazine’s Outstanding Individuals in Industry Awards picked another crop of winners from around Asia presenting them with the coveted trophy at the Gala Dinner on 15 July. This year was the first year that the nominees had not been notified in advance and winning came as a happy surprise for many of the winners. The 2011 Awards nomination season was declared open.

Claire Saeki, Publisher, RFP Magazine said “Already in its 3rd year the Outstanding Individual Awards in Industry have proved to be a true barometer of talent in our industry with consistently high nominations making the judges decision-making process extremely challenging. A special issue of RFP Magazine will follow the event where all the winners will be interviewed. Winners were as follows:

  • Architectural Systems and Design
    Andre Fu,  ASFO, for the Design of the Upper House hotel.
  • Business Development
    Ong Soo Yar, Jones Lang LaSalle, for her outstanding success in creating substantial growth for the Jones Lang LaSalle Integrated Facilities Management business in China.
  • Environmental Performance
    Michael Friedlander, APG Asset Management, for his commitment to delivering environmental performance in existing buildings and setting up and delivering a US$100 million China specific energy fund.
  • Excellence in Facilities Management
    Andy Coy,  EC Harris, for successfully implementing a change management program for the HSBC portfolio in a very challenging economic climate.
  • Industry Champion.
    Rob Blain,  CBRE, for his contributions in promoting the real estate industry as a whole, his commitment to environmental sustainability and his work with the community and philanthropic initiatives.
  • Landmark Project Achievement
    Mr Ong Tze Boon, Ong & Ong Pte Ltd., for his innovative and contemporary design of the Quincy hotel in Singapore.
  • Project Manager of the Year
    Ada Fung, Jones Lang LaSalle, for the successful relocation of the Baker McKenzie offices to one pacific place.
  • Real Estate Strategy
    Previndran Singhe, Zerin, for securing the strategic expansion partnership between Tune hotels and Evolution Capital.
  • Real Estate Transactions
    Sarky Subramaniam, Knight Frank Malaysia, for successfully negotiating nearly 700,000 sqft of office space for Shell Malaysia.
  • Transformational Project Leader
    Andrew Macpherson, EC Harris, for successfully managing the extremely difficult task of the physical transformation of the building and facilities at the HSBC main building.

About the Awards
RFP's Outstanding Individuals in Industry Awards were created in 2007 as a way of celebrating personal success rather than focussing merely on companies and project results. Already an institution, the awards have continued to attract nominations from the industry's most renowned and well respected professionals.
